(often colloquially referred to as the 3144 "Patched" or "Top") is a specific, modified firmware flashing tool that has become a staple in the Samsung Android modding community. While official Odin versions are released by Samsung for internal use, the "Patched" versions—most notably those maintained by developers like Raymond Lai (Real_Pac)—serve a critical role in bypassing factory restrictions. The Purpose of the Patch

Standard Odin is designed to verify every file it flashes. If you try to install a firmware binary from a different region (CSC) or a modified kernel, the official tool will often throw a "SHA256 Checksum" error. This is a security measure to ensure the device remains within its intended software ecosystem. Odin 3144 Patched

version removes these integrity checks. It allows enthusiasts to: Change Regions:

Flash a different country’s firmware to get faster Android updates. Bypass Bloatware:

Move from a carrier-branded version (like Verizon or AT&T) to the "U1" unbranded factory firmware. Cross-Flash:

Install compatible firmware that the official tool would otherwise reject due to model number mismatches. Technical Significance

The "3144" designation refers to the specific build version (v3.14.4). This version was particularly important because it brought full support for newer Samsung compression formats (lz4), which were introduced with Android 10 and 11. Without the 3.14.4 architecture, older versions of Odin would simply crash when attempting to process modern, heavy firmware files.

Everything You Need to Know About Odin 3.14.4 Patched If you’ve ever ventured into the world of Samsung customization, you’ve likely encountered Odin, the proprietary internal tool used by Samsung technicians to flash firmware, kernels, and recoveries. While the standard version is powerful, the Odin 3.14.4 Patched (often referred to as "Odin 3.14.4 Patched Top") is the preferred choice for power users. What is Odin 3.14.4 Patched?

Standard Odin versions often come with restrictions, such as strict model checks or limited access to specific partitions like "Userdata". The patched version—frequently shared by developers in communities like XDA-Developers—removes these safeguards. This allows users to flash firmware that might otherwise be blocked, such as "unbranded" software on a carrier-locked device or older software versions (downgrading). Key Features of the 3.14.4 Patched Version

Removed Model Mismatch Errors: Bypasses "SHA256" or "Model Check" errors that often stop a flash if the firmware region doesn't exactly match the device.

Access to Hidden Slots: Enables the "Userdata" slot and other advanced configuration buttons that are typically grayed out in standard versions.

Stability for New Devices: Version 3.14.4 specifically improved support for newer devices like the Galaxy S20 and Note 20 series, ensuring better communication between the PC and the phone's Download Mode.

Odin 3.14.4 Patched is a modified version of Samsung’s internal flashing utility, specifically designed to bypass common software restrictions encountered during firmware installation. While the official Odin tool is intended for authorized repair centers, this "patched" version is widely used by the Android community to manage Samsung Galaxy devices more flexibly. What Makes the Patched Version Different?

Standard versions of Odin often perform strict checks on the firmware being flashed. The patched version, frequently sourced from XDA-Developers, includes several key modifications:

Bypassing SHA256 Checks: Allows users to flash cross-carrier or modified firmware that the official tool might reject due to signature mismatches.

Decryption Support: Modern Samsung firmware (Android 8.0+) uses LZ4 encryption; version 3.14.4 is built to decrypt and read these files during the flashing process.

Unlocked Options: It can enable hidden features in the Odin.ini file, making "greyed out" options like USERDATA or specific partitions accessible. Core Functionality
